ECW was one extreme contradiction piled on top of another. It was an incredibly influential company in the world of professional wrestling during the 1990s, yet it was never profitable. It portrayed itself as the ultimate in anti-authority rebellion, but its leadership was, at various points, working covertly with the two wrestling giants, the World Wrestling Federation and World Championship Wrestling. Most of all, it blurred the line between real life and the fantasy world of professional wrestling like no other company before it - many of those who thought they were conning others ended up being victims of the ultimate con.
Hardcore History: The Extremely Unauthorized Story of the ECW offers a frank and balanced look at the evolution of the company, starting even before its early days as a Philadelphia-area independent group called Eastern Championship Wrestling in 1992 and extending past the death of Extreme Championship Wrestling in 2001. Writer Scott E. Williams has pored through records and conducted dozens of interviews with fans, company officials, business partners, and the wrestlers themselves to bring listeners the most thorough account possible of this bizarre company.
The book sets out to answer several questions: Did World Championship Wrestling really try to destroy ECW by draining off its talent? Was Vince McMahon secretly as a friend to ECW, as he has claimed? What really caused the death of ECW? Who lied to whom? Hardcore History: The Extremely Unauthorized Story of the ECW will address all of those mysteries and many more in a story that is sure to be extremely controversial for fans and critics of both the ECW and professional wrestling.

Great subject, awful writing
By chain reader
As a long time ECW fan I was really looking forward to this book. I enjoyed the stories in the book but it was a difficult read due to the authors writing styles. This was a hard book to get into because the author would continously start thoughts and then seem to wander to another topic without completing his initial thought. Many times he also seemed to start stories in the middle. Very frustrating and difficult to read. A real disappointment since the author seemed to have good sources and ideas they just did not translate to the written word. I would suggest that if you an old ECW fan to pick this up at a library or when it goes to paperback but not waste the money on harcover.

The next wrestling book
By R. Howell
While wrestling television is in a decline, the industry has turned to churning out more and more books on the subject, with which we can largely blame/thank Mick Foley. Don't get me wrong, I read most of the biographies that have been released. ECW comes to the forefront in this 300 page text. The author does a good job on his run down of the history of ECW and the multiple creative characters that developed there and then went on to national exposure with WCW and WWF/E. It's actually a pretty good read but there is a bit of a problem with chronology as the author skipped back and forth in time. I liked the chapter of "where are they now" but the whole book is worth reading as it is not published by the WWE so you don't get the revisioned history of ECW as in the "The Rise and Fall of ECW" dvd or the clone book based on that dvd The Rise & Fall of ECW: Extreme Championship Wrestling (WWE)put out by the WWE. A good chunk of this book almost seems to transform into a biography for Paul Heyman but since he was such an integral force behind ECW that should be natural. I'd like to have seen more pictures of the personalities/characters in ECW. I would also have liked to have seen a title history list of the holders of the ECW championship, TV title, and tag titles.
Certainly worth adding to your collection, but new fan that have been weened on current WWE just won't get it. Children should also be warned away. I found it interesting without getting bogged down by random ramblings about inconsequential details. Thumbs up on this one.

Half-assed
By Kenneth A. Mcbride
Hardcore History is not a bad read as such. Lots of the quotes are fun, and you do get a feel for how important and exciting ECW was for action-starved hardcore fans in the early to mid 1990s. Scott Williams' research is a joke, though. He misses out key matches and angles, and gets others confused beyond belief. Anyone who really followed the company would spot these errors a mile off, and anyone else could check them in 30 seconds just by Googling show names. For the *real* history of ECW, John Lister's "Turning The Tables" is still the gold standard.
